No One Asks “Why?”

Why do we need this formula? Why memorize this list? Why sit in rows and copy? Schools don’t like why. “Because it’s on the test” is the ultimate intellectual insult. A real education starts with why—and never stops asking it.
Education has historically been built upon a model of compliance, rote memorization, and standardization.This framework prioritizes uniformity over individuality and promotes a passive learning style that values the regurgitation of facts over the application of knowledge.
At the crux of this model lies a deeply entrenched aversion to questioning — especially why certain content is relevant or necessary.
The phrase "Because it's on the test" epitomizes this limitation, encapsulating a mindset that stifles inquiry and marginalizes genuine understanding.
A radical rethinking of educational frameworks is essential, transitioning to a system where the act of questioning, particularly "why," serves as the foundation of learning and knowledge acquisition.
The notion that students should passively absorb information presents a significant barrier to meaningful education.
This approach ignores the reality that in an interconnected global economy, the ability to critically evaluate, adapt, and innovate is paramount.
In competitive and dynamic environments, individuals equipped solely with facts and formulas lack the tools necessary to navigate complex problems.
Thus, adopting a paradigm that prioritizes inquiry, starting from the very first question — why?
— promotes not only deeper understanding but also cultivates a skill set aligned with entrepreneurial thinking and real-world application.
Integrating the question of "why" necessitates a fundamental redesign of curricula.
Educational institutions should prioritize conceptual understanding and problem-solving over mere content delivery.
This shift can be accomplished by scaffolding learning around themes that resonate with students’ interests and societal challenges.
For instance, a curriculum centered on environmental sustainability could encourage students to explore the complexities of climate change, investigate potential solutions, and develop actionable projects.
Such a design fosters not only academic mastery but also equips students with tools for entrepreneurship and civic engagement.
Moreover, the significance of a "why" centered approach extends to pedagogical methodologies.
Traditional teaching methods that emphasize passive reception must give way to inquiry-based learning environments where questions drive the educational experience.
Classrooms should facilitate dialogue, encouraging students to ask questions, challenge assumptions, and explore diverse perspectives.
This interactive learning model positions students as active participants in their education, empowering them to seek out the relevance of what they learn.
Educators should act as facilitators, guiding students in their exploration of knowledge rather than simply delivering information in a one-dimensional format.
